Every year the Upper Elementary students present The River Model which is the beginning lesson in exploring how water works on the earth.
The study involves building a river model and then demonstrating how water flows according to its design and how land on the water bank is effected by its flow. Learning is also focused on runoff as well as point and non-point source pollution. The Lower Elementary classes study the parts of a river. |
